Curiosity Club: Ice Fingers, Fire Rainbows, and More! In-Person
Join us for Curiosity Club, a monthly adventure for curious Kindergarteners - 2nd Graders and their grown-ups!
Each month, this engaging program will explore a new, exciting topic—from quirky animals and unusual inventions to faraway places and strange-but-true facts. Through books, hands-on activities, and snacks, we’ll uncover surprising stories and fascinating discoveries that spark imagination and wonder.
This month, we'll explore wild natural phenomena like fungi gnat larvae, circumhorizontal arcs, brinicles, an iron-rich hypersaline waterfall, and more!
Adults are required to stay with their child/ren throughout the program. Younger and/or older siblings are welcome.
Sponsored by the Friends of the William Jeanes Library.
Registration required.
